Kachumbari
Ingredients
- 4 ripe tomatoes diced
- 1 red onion finely chopped
- 1 cucumber diced
- 1 green chili pepper (optional) finely chopped
- 1-2 lime juice (adjust to taste)
- Salt to taste
- Fresh cilantro leaves chopped (optional)
Instructions
- In a mixing bowl, combine the diced tomatoes, chopped red onion, diced cucumber, and chopped green chili pepper (if using).
- Squeeze the lime juice over the salad mixture, and add salt to taste. Mix well to combine all the ingredients.
- If desired, sprinkle fresh cilantro leaves on top for added flavor and garnish.
- Allow the flavors to meld together by refrigerating the Kachumbari for about 15-30 minutes before serving.
- Serve chilled as a side dish alongside your favorite East African dishes. It pairs well with grilled meats, chapati, or even as a topping for rice.
